Olympic scandal rocks Brazil as swimmer Ana Carolina Vieira gets booted from Paris 2024.

advertisement

  via Getty  

Her crime? Sneaking out of the athlete’s village with her boyfriend.

advertisement

  via Gettyimages  

The culprit duo? Vieira and fellow swimmer Gabriel Santos.

  via Getty Images  

While Santos got a slap on the wrist, Vieira faced the full force of the Olympic hammer.

The drama traces back to the women’s 4×100 meter freestyle relay.

  via Getty Images  

On July 27, Vieira had competed, but the Brazilian team came in 12th.

  via Getty Images  

No finals for them, as Australia clinched the top spot.
